Enter the ‘sms casino‘ payment method. For those unfamiliar, an SMS casino payment allows users to deposit money into their online casino accounts via an SMS. This method eliminates the need for a user to have a bank account or credit card. All they need is a mobile phone with an active connection.

Here’s how it typically works:

  • The player chooses the SMS deposit option in the online casino’s payment section.
  • They enter their mobile phone number and the amount they wish to deposit.
  • The player receives an SMS, which they need to confirm.

Once confirmed, the deposit amount is either added to their monthly phone bill or deducted from their prepaid balance.

There are several advantages to this method:

  • Speed: Deposits are almost instantaneous.
  • Accessibility: It’s accessible to those without traditional banking facilities.
  • Security: The transaction doesn’t require sharing of sensitive bank or card information.

However, as with all payment methods, the sms casino approach isn’t without its drawbacks. There’s typically a limit to how much one can deposit using this method, which might not cater to high-rollers. Additionally, withdrawals aren’t usually supported, requiring an alternative method for players to access their winnings.

  1. Digital Wallets: A digital wallet refers to electronic devices and programs used for making electronic transactions. They can store multiple card numbers and details to make transactions more accessible and quicker. One of the primary advantages is the enhanced security features, including tokenization of card details, ensuring that the user’s primary account details remain hidden during transactions.

  3. Biometric Authentication: As security remains paramount in online transactions, biometric authentication methods are being integrated more widely. Fingerprints, facial recognition, and even retina scans are being used to authenticate transactions, ensuring that even if one’s device is compromised, their financial details remain safe.
